The master gardener Ulrich Pacyna has built a hobbit hut for up to eight people next to the log cabin in Herschbach, where he has lived with his wife Britta and dog Fritz since 2000. Pacyna spent three years building the hut, using the remains of demolished houses and former telegraph poles.

Visitors frequently enjoy the Panorama Shelter Hohenleimbach for its expansive views over the Eastern Eifel. The Meisenthal barbecue hut is also highly rated, offering a wave lounger and views of the volcanic landscape. Another favorite is the Grill Hut Steinkaul (Bodenbach), known for its historical setting on a former Roman quarry wall.

Yes, the Grill Hut Steinkaul (Bodenbach) is notable for its historical context. It's located on a former quarry wall that was used by Romans, who extracted stones for building a nearby Roman villa. This hut offers a unique resting place in the Bodenbach valley with a connection to ancient history.

The huts around Meuspath vary in their offerings. Many are shelters providing a protected spot for a break, while barbecue huts like the Meisenthal barbecue hut and Grill Hut Steinkaul (Bodenbach) are equipped for grilling. Some, like the Meisenthal barbecue hut, even feature amenities like a wave lounger for relaxation. The Hobbit Hut Herschbach is known for offering drinks.
Yes, the Hobbit Hut Herschbach stands out as a particularly charming and unique hiker's cabin. It was built by a master gardener using recycled materials and offers a cozy spot for a break, even providing drinks for visitors.

Yes, the Boos Barbecue and Shelter Hut is described as being somewhat hidden in the forest. It offers a refuge on the Booser Doppelmaar circular route, providing a tranquil spot away from more frequented paths.
Absolutely. The Panorama Shelter Hohenleimbach is specifically named for its great panoramic view over the Eastern Eifel region, providing a protected spot to take in the scenery. The Meisenthal barbecue hut also offers wonderful views of the small Meisenthal and the surrounding volcanic landscape.
